
The Aston Martin V12 Vantage has arrived. Evolving the styling and engineering exercise Aston unveiled in 2007 and set for debut at Geneva Motor Show, they claim the V12 Vantage is the most driver-focused
Power is provided by a 6.0 liters V12 making 510 hp at 6500 rpm and 420 lb-ft of torque at 5750 rpm. The Vantage's new-found grunt is sent through a carbon fiber driveshaft to a rear-mounted six-speed manual gearbox. The benefits of a transmission oil cooler and a new rear diffuser helps to cool the limited slip differential. Aston claims a 0-60 time of 4.1 seconds and top speed of 190 mph.
